Disaster drills shall be conducted in ARF homes at least once
___________________________. 80023(d) -✓✓Every 6 months
What must licensees do when they change the conditions or limitations described on
their license, such as location or capacity? -✓✓File a new licensing application
A follow-up visit shall be conducted to determine compliance with the plan of correction
specified in the notice of deficiency within __________________________ unless the
licensee has demonstrated by some other means that the deficiency was corrected as
required. 80053(a)(1) -✓✓10 working days
What is the timeline for an ARF to report a special incident to Community Care
Licensing by fax or telephone? 80061(b) -✓✓By the next working day during CCL's
normal business hours
The licensee has ___________________________ days to mail a Special Incident
Report to Community Care Licensing? 80061(b) -✓✓7 days
How long does the licensee have to report a change of their CEO or Licensee's mailing
address? 80061(c)(2)(3) -✓✓10 working days
How long does the licensee have to report a change in the ARF's plan of operation?
80061(c)(4) -✓✓10 working days
Who can change the label on a prescribed medication? 80071(n)(4) -✓✓Nobody but the
dispensing pharmacist.
Centrally stored medication records must be maintained for how long? 80075(N)(7) -
✓✓1 year
An ARF administrator shall be at least how old? 85064(c), 85964.2(B)(3)(b) -✓✓21
What are the education requirements for an administrator of a 8-bed ARF? 85064(d) -
✓✓High school diploma or GED
An ARF certificate holder who wants to administer a home for 50 residents shall meet
what requirements prior to employment as an administrator? 85064(i)(1)(2) -✓✓High
, school diploma or GED and completion of 60 college units OR 4 years of work
experience in residential care
How many hours per week must an administrator be available to work in each care
home he/she administers? 85064(d)(1) -✓✓The number of hours necessary to manage
and administer the facility in compliance with applicable law and regulation
When an administrator is absent from the facility, what are the coverage requirements"
85064(f) -✓✓Coverage by a designated substitute who is capable of running the home
and who meets the qualifications listed in section 80065
What are the three things a person must do to become a certified administrator?
85064(B)(1)(2)(3)(d) -✓✓Complete the initial training class, pass a written exam, submit
an application form along with a processing fee of $100
An administrator must pass a written exam administered by ACS within ____________
days of completing the initial certification program? 85064.3(b)(2) -✓✓60 days
An administrator must submit an application form to ACS within ____________ of being
notified of having passed the ARF administrator exam? -✓✓30 days
The amount of the ARF administrator certification processing fee is? 85064(b)(3)(d) -
✓✓$100
ARF administrator certificates must be renewed every ______________. 85064.2(e) -
✓✓2 years
in order for an ARF administrator to renew their certificate the certificate holder shall
submit a written application or letter to the _____________________ located in
Sacramento. 85064.3 -✓✓CCL Administrator Certification Section (ACS)
In order for an ARF administrator to renew their certificate the certificate holder shall
submit a written application or letter to the ___________________. 85064.3 -✓✓ACS
An administrator must earn how many CEU's within a 2 year period to renew their
administrator certification? 85064.3 -✓✓40
In order for an ARF administrator to renew their administrator's certificate prior to the
certificate's expiration date, the certificate holder shall submit... 85064.3(C)(1)(2)(3) -
✓✓a written request to recertify post-marked on or before the certificate expiration date,
evidence of completion of 40 CEU's, and a payment of $100 processing (renewal) fee
If an administrator does not renew their administrator's certificate within 2 years, what is
the delinquency fee? 85064.3(d)(3) -✓✓$300
